RT Zeus (@ZeusRWA)You can list a tokenized vineyard on a DEX. But if nobody wants to buy vineyard tokens at 2am on a Thursday, this means that the token is illiquid. Most people in RWAs don't understand the difference between a listing and liquidity.So what is liquidity? In easy to follow terms, it means how quickly and easily you can sell something without losing money. Cash is the most liquid asset in the world. You can spend it anywhere, instantly. Deloitte Flags Risk in Instant Settlement for Tokenized Assets
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-27 01:00
Core Insights - Deloitte warns that the rapid advancement of tokenized securities may pose safety risks due to hidden weaknesses in systems that enable instant trade settlements [1][3][5] Group 1: Tokenized Securities Overview - Tokenized securities represent real-world assets like stocks and bonds on a blockchain, functioning as digital receipts that verify ownership [2] - The trend of tokenizing assets is accelerating as companies aim to place stocks, bonds, and funds on blockchains to enhance efficiency and reduce costs [1] Group 2: Settlement Concerns - Deloitte's primary concern revolves around T+0 settlement, which allows for instant trade settlements, contrasting with the traditional two-day settlement period that provides a buffer for addressing issues [3] - The absence of this buffer in instant settlements can lead to immediate and irreversible damage if a trade counterpart fails or if there is a malfunction in the code [3][5] Group 3: Ethereum's Shanghai Upgrade Impact - Ethereum's Shanghai upgrade has increased interest in tokenized treasuries and on-chain yields, with around 5% of validators opting to unstake their ETH, revealing potential delays even in systems designed for instant transactions [4][5] - Large asset managers are citing the Shanghai upgrade in Ethereum ETF filings as proof of the network's capability to manage significant financial flows, further driving interest in tokenized products [5] Group 4: Implications for Investors - Regular crypto investors utilizing platforms linked to tokenized assets may be more exposed to these risks than they realize, as many staking services and yield products depend on effective settlement processes [6] - Regulatory actions, such as the SEC's $30 million fine against Kraken for unregistered securities related to staking services, highlight the volatility and rapid changes in the regulatory landscape affecting tokenized yield products [7]
